This patch to the Go frontend ignores the function type result name
when producing export data.  This change ensures that we never output
a result name in the export data if there is only a single result.
Previously we would output a ? if the single result had a name.  That
made the output unstable, because the hashing ignores the result name,
so whether we output a ? or not depended on how equal hash elements
were handled.  This is for GCC PR 104832.  Bootstrapped and ran Go
testsuite on x86_64-pc-linux-gnu.  Committed to mainline.
